    Is it possible to upgrade the satnav on my 2008 A6 to a full post code version? Thanks
    I think it depends on which MMI you have. If it's MMI 2G or MMI 3G low, then no. If you have MMI 3G high, there are upgrades out there:

    MMi 3G High 2020 or 2017Maps 7 digit postcode with latest firmware update

    Is your car a facelift model with MMI 3G High? The MMI unit will be in the glovebox rather than the boot, and there will be a "top hat" joystick on top of the rotary MMI controller knob.

    I have the MMI 3G low so have the rubbish postcode search, but I decided to update the 2010 maps. Took ages, had to try the "firmware update" several times, the result is a navigation system that I never use. It gives stupid routes, and gives ridiculous arrival times. My advice is to stick with your separate satnav or app on your phone.
